Inside the 2009 ML350, Mercedes-Benz focused on enhancing the user experience. The updated COMAND interface is a central highlight, designed for improved intuitiveness and ease of use. This system integrates essential features such as Bluetooth phone connectivity, ensuring seamless communication on the go, and an auxiliary jack for diverse audio input options. For audiophiles, an in-dash six-CD/DVD changer comes standard. Furthermore, for those desiring cutting-edge technology, an optional premium COMAND system elevates the in-car tech to new heights. This upgraded system boasts voice-activated, hard-drive-based navigation, providing sophisticated route guidance and incorporating 4GB of storage for personal music libraries. Satellite radio and HD radio expand entertainment choices, while integrated Zagat restaurant reviews offer convenient dining recommendations. An iPod connector further enhances connectivity for personal devices.

In a competitive market segment filled with updated rivals such as the Acura MDX, Audi Q7, BMW X5, Lexus RX 350, Porsche Cayenne, and Volkswagen Touareg 2, the ML350 distinguishes itself with its blend of established reputation and contemporary features. While it does not offer a third-row seat like some competitors, the 2009 Mercedes-Benz ML350 excels in providing a luxurious and comfortable environment for five passengers.
